From: Jouni Malinen Date: Wed, 20 May 2009 18:59:08 +0000 (+0300) Subject: ath9k: Update Beacon timers based on timestamp from the AP X-Git-Tag: v2.6.31-rc1~14^2~390^2~24 X-Git-Url: http://review.tizen.org/git/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=ccdfeab6536ae55d43436ffaae949afde6e962ca;p=platform%2Fkernel%2Flinux-exynos.git ath9k: Update Beacon timers based on timestamp from the AP Some APs seem to drift away from the expected TBTT (timestamp % beacon_int_in_usec differs quite a bit from zero) which can result in us waking up way too early to receive a Beacon frame. In order to work around this, re-configure the Beacon timers after having received a Beacon frame from the AP (i.e., when we know the offset between the expected TBTT and the actual time the AP is sending out the Beacon frame).
